2023 Royal Canadian Mint Mosaic of Canadian Icons 6-Coin Set

July 31, 2023 by Colonial Acres Coins

Last updated on July 2nd, 2025 at 11:47 am

Last Updated on July 2, 2025 Posted by Colonial Acres Coins

The 2023 Mosaic of Canada Icons 6-coin set is an extraordinary chance to lay hands on your favourite classic Canadian coin designs with a unique twist. The Royal Canadian Mint has decided to dedicate its efforts to honour the reign of Queen Elizabeth II (1952-2022) and will not be issuing any standard 2023-dated Canadian circulation coins with her portrait, instead offering a limited collector’s edition for each of the six Canadian coin denominations.

But wait, there’s more! This special Collector’s Edition is the ultimate tribute to our country’s beloved symbols, official or not. The 50-cent piece has been modified to represent Canadian icons. Mosaic of Canadian Icons Displayed on the 50-Cent Coin

The 50-cent piece is undoubtedly the highlight of this set. The obverse of the coin features the effigy of Queen Elizabeth II and the dates of her reign. The reverse, traditionally the coat of arms, is replaced by a spectacular mosaic of red and white coloured symbols highlighting the best of Canada. Alisha Giroux, the artist, combined these elements into a pattern that showcases the Canadian maple leaf.

Learn more about these Canadian symbols incorporated into the stunning coin design.

THE POLAR BEARThe Polar Bear

It’s estimated that Canada is home to two-thirds of the population of polar bears, the largest bear in the world. Polar bears are only found along the Arctic coastlines in the northern hemisphere. This majestic animal represents strength and endurance as they raise their young and survive in a harsh climate.

THE HOCKEY SKATEThe Hockey Skate

Hockey is more than a national sport, it’s a way of life. The hockey skate is a profound symbol for Canadians, embodying their national pride and love for the sport. It signifies not only their passion for ice hockey but also represents the country’s cultural identity and historic connection to winter sports.

CANOE WITH OARSCanoe With Oars

Even in the modern age, the canoe remains a dependable means of transport. For Indigenous Peoples, it’s more than just a vessel – it’s a symbol of their identity, embodying community and familial bonds. During the sun-soaked days of summer, canoeing provides Canadians with a unique opportunity to explore the breathtaking beauty of nature via the country’s serene lakes.

THE BEAVERThe Beaver

The beaver is an iconic symbol of Canada, featured on the 5-cent coin. It shares the spotlight on this 50-cent coin. In 1975, the beaver became an official symbol of Canada, under royal assent, but they’ve held special status in Canada for over 300 years. Beavers are native to Canada and are considered the largest rodent in North America.

THE TOQUEThe Toque

This knitted cap gets its name from the French “tuque,” as it probably originated with French or Métis fur traders. It’s become representative of Canadian winter sportswear, whether the wearer is snow-shoeing, tobogganing, curling or just playing outside in the snow.

THE MOOSEThe Moose

Moose are endemic to Canada and are considered another iconic symbol of the country. As the largest member of the deer family, they can be found almost everywhere in Canada, except Vancouver Island and the Arctic. Moose are some of the largest mammals in Canada, but their habitats are declining, which hurts their population.

CURLING STONECurling Stone

Curling holds a special place in the hearts of Canadians, serving as a cherished pastime and an integral part of their cultural heritage. Curling is not unique to Canada, but it is one of the most popular sports in the country. Introduced by Scottish immigrants in the early 1800s, it continues to embody the spirit of sportsmanship and strategic play for Canadians from coast to coast.

THE SNOWY OWLThe Snowy Owl  

The snowy owl, all decked out in its fancy white feathers, is pretty important to us Canadians. It’s even the official bird of Quebec! People see it as a sign of wisdom and toughing it out, kind of like how we respect nature and handle our chilly winters with grit.
